Pristimantis llanganati Navarrete, Venegas, and Ron, 2016

Class: Amphibia > Order: Anura > Superfamily: Brachycephaloidea > Family: Strabomantidae > Subfamily: Pristimantinae > Genus: Pristimantis > Species: Pristimantis llanganati

Pristimantis llanganati Navarrete, Venegas, and Ron, 2016, ZooKeys, 593: 150. Holotype: QCAZ 46140, by original designation. Type locality: "Ecuador, Provincia Napo, Cantón Tena, “La Cueva” at the confluence of the Mulatos and Langoa rivers (0.9663° S, 78.2224° W), 2483 m above the sea". http://zoobank.org/4B160419-87CB-48AE-85BF-B66C263A9B18 

English Names

Llanganates Rain Frog (original publication). 

Distribution

Known from three localities (elevation range is 2253–2883 m) from Provincia del Napo, Parque Nacional Llanganates, along the Salcedo-Tena road, Ecuador. 

Geographic Occurrence

Natural Resident: Ecuador

Endemic: Ecuador

Comment

Not assigned to a species group in the original publication.
